A leading tech company in the United Kingdom is seeking a Cloud Security Engineer to design and manage organisation-wide cloud policies. The ideal candidate will have 5-7 years of experience in Cybersecurity and CNAP policy implementation, along with expertise in AWS IAM and Azure.

Responsibilities include:

  • Collaborating with DevOps teams
  • Integrating security in the software development lifecycle
  • Implementing automation for cloud security posture management

To be effective, strong collaboration skills are essential.
